Where to stay in Paraiso

Jardins
Museums, shopping and cafes highlight some of the noteworthy features of Jardins. Make a stop by Paulista Avenue or Museum of Image and Sound while you're exploring the neighbourhood.

Itaim Bibi
Take time in Itaim Bibi to visit attractions like Parque do Povo and JK Iguatemi Shopping Mall. You might also appreciate the abundant dining options, and you can hop on the metro at Campo Belo Station to see more of the city.

Moema
Moema is well liked for its restaurants and live music. If you're hoping to get in some sightseeing, Shopping Ibirapuera and Ibirapuera Gymnasium are top spots, and you can jump on the metro at Eucaliptos Subway Station or Moema Station to get around.

Pinheiros
Pinheiros is a destination travellers like for its bars, and you might hop aboard the metro at Faria Lima Station or Pinheiros Metro Station to explore sights like Batman's Alley.

Vila Mariana
Vila Mariana is well liked for its museums and live music. If you're hoping to get in some sightseeing, Paulista Avenue and Shopping Metro Santa Cruz are top spots, and you can jump on the metro at Vila Mariana Station or Ana Rosa Station to get around.
